stockfish: strong chess engine, to play chess against

 free chess engine derived from Glaurung 2.1. It is a chess engine, so it
 requires an UCI (universal chess interface) compatible GUI like XBoard
 (with PolyGlot), eboard, Jose, Arena or scid in order to be used comfortably.
 It is the strongest open source chess engine by october 2009 in the
 "computer chess rating list" CCRL. Written in C++ it uses multiple threads
 and cores. It is capable of Chess960 and has experimental support for polyglot
 opening books.
